Listing remarks
Adorable partially furnished chalet! Perfect starter home on nearly an acre or potential turn key rental or AirBnB! Open main floor complete with kitchen, living room, quaint bathroom and french doors leading to a large back deck. The loft bedroom has newer carpet and a queen size bed and dresser. Nice long driveway offers road privacy and lots of parking. Comes with a generator, TV's, furniture and everything you need to move in and stay right away.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
